BUSHRANGER
Kerry Medway
Set in the Southern Highlands, a teenager, John Dunn, runs away from home and joins the infamous bushranger, Ben Hall's gang. He shoots a policeman and is hung for murder at age 19. Before John Dunn died, he committed his life to Jesus Christ and led his cell-mate in Darlinghurst Goal to Christ. An historical novel, featuring Australia's bushranging folklore that will impact many Aussies for Christ.
